Abstract

The invention discloses a kind of mining development machine, connected by passage oil cylinder including driving part, framework for support part and passage oil cylinder, described driving part and framework for support part;Described passage oil cylinder is used for providing driving force, alternately, promotes driving part reach using framework for support part as fulcrum, pulls framework for support part to move forward using driving part as fulcrum.The present invention elapses progression with simple oil cylinder, replaces complicated crawler travel hydraulic driving mode, greatly simplifies development machine structure, and has that cost is low, failure rate is low, applied widely, the feature of good damping effect, is suitable to popularization and application.

Background technology
At present, China's coal-mine tunnelling machine technology develops quickly, but down-hole development machine and ground engineering machinery Equally, mainly based on operation, not belonging to walking machine, ground surface works machinery is required for by other with down-hole development machine Transport Machinery transports setting to and carries out operation.
Existing development machine generally individually uses crawler travel fluid power system, has the drawback that (1) crawler travel liquid Pressure drive system is by multi-part groups such as track frame, directive wheel, thrust wheel, track takeup, traveling speed reducer, running motors Becoming, cost is high, easily break down;(2) individually crawler bearing area is little, bigger, for mud stone base plate, muddy road than pressure over the ground During condition, hydrops serious driving face, tunneling effect is poor;(3), during development machine work, rear support portion and front shovel board portion will tunnel Machine track frame is unsettled, reduces vibrations during its work by development machine own wt, and damping effect is poor.
As can be seen here, above-mentioned existing mining development machine in structure and uses, it is clear that still suffered from inconvenience and defect, and Urgently it is further improved.How to found a kind of simple in construction, applied widely, the new mining driving of good damping effect Machine, becomes the target that current industry pole need to be improved.

Detailed description of the invention
The mining development machine of one of the present invention, uses passage oil cylinder to connect driving part and framework for support part;With passage Oil cylinder, as driving force, drives development machine walking, and the Main Function wherein elapsing oil cylinder is: alternately, with framework for support part Promote driving part reach as fulcrum, pull framework for support part to move forward using driving part as fulcrum.The present invention is according to well Lower tunnel straight line, the digging footage of every day is generally less than the feature of 20m, elapses progression with simple oil cylinder, replaces Complicated crawler travel hydraulic driving mode, makes development machine structure simpler, and fault rate is lower.
Meet the above-mentioned condition as fulcrum may is that 1, weight relatively large;2 are provided with stabilising arrangement, can be carried out Location.
In detail below as a example by a kind of mining development machine, the present invention will be described in detail.
As shown in Figure 1, 2, a kind of mining development machine includes: driving part 1, framework for support part 2, passage oil cylinder 3, passage Oil cylinder 3 connects driving part 1 and framework for support part 2, it is preferred to use 2 symmetrically arranged hydraulic jacks.Driving part 1 includes Cutting part 11, rotary table 12, body 13, scratch board conveyor 14, shovel board portion 15, stabilising arrangement 16;Wherein, cutting part 11 passes through Rotary table 12 is arranged on above body 13 front end, and shovel board portion 15 is arranged on below body 13 front end, and scratch board conveyor 14 is pacified Being contained on body 13, arrange before and after body 13, stabilising arrangement 16 uses four sets, the both sides before and after body 13 Respectively it is provided with a set of.Framework for support part 2 includes base 21 and the electrical system 22 being arranged on base 21, hydraulic system 23, balancing weight 24, base 1 also can install other parts according to development machine master-plan demand.
Above-mentioned framework for support part 2 is by arranging balancing weight 24, and its weight, more than driving part 1, makes passage oil cylinder 3 permissible Driving part 1 is promoted to move forward and the big gun head of cutting part 11 can be made to cut with the framework for support part 2 that weight is relatively large for fulcrum Rib.
Aforementioned stable device 16 is reach structure, and it stretches out front end face and is provided with group dental structure, when passage oil cylinder 3 with Framework for support part 2, as fulcrum, after promoting driving part 1 to move forward and making the big gun head incision rib of cutting part 11, is arranged on pick Enter before and after machine totally four set stabilising arrangements 16 to start to stretch out, utilize group's dental structure of stabilising arrangement 16 front end face tightly to help coal with two Wall pressure is dead, makes driving part 1 rely on stabilising arrangement 16 to help the pressure of rib to two, formed one can not around, have up and down The stable entirety of displacement, loses the degree of freedom of top to bottom, left and right, front and rear motion, and such setting, one is to make passage oil cylinder 3 When pulling framework for support part 2, can be using driving part 1 as fulcrum, two are the reduction of development machine upper and lower, left and right cutting coal Vibrations during wall, good damping effect, there is cutting Stabilization.
The development machine of the present invention, relative to existing development machine, without crawler travel portion, supporting part without issue;Driving part 1 and The walking form of framework for support part 2, is and lands walking, and contact area is far longer than crawler bearing area, less than pressure over the ground. Concrete walking of landing is achieved in that, the body 13 of driving part 1 lengthens on the basis of existing and becomes falling of driving part Ground pedestal, the base 21 of framework for support part 2 becomes the pedestal that lands of framework for support part, makes driving part 1 and framework for support Part 2 fulcrum each other completes development machine complete machine reach action.
The development machine of the present invention, relative to existing development machine, shovel board portion 15 uses wide cut to stretch shovel board, and on-fixed width Width shovel board, so under development machine straight line moving state, coal can be loaded scratch board conveyor 14 without left and right skew by development machine In, improve loading efficiency.It addition, scratch board conveyor 14 needs to be also carried out extension design according to structure.
The overall arrangement of existing development machine the most single set dynamical system, and the development machine of the present invention, dynamical system is adopted By left and right bi-motor, double set arrangements of power system forms of biliquid press pump.
The driving step of above-mentioned a kind of mining development machine is:
Step 1, passage oil cylinder 3, using framework for support part 2 as fulcrum, promotes driving part 1 to move forward one and tunnels step office (about 0.9m) also makes the big gun head of cutting part 11 cut rib, as shown in Figure 3 simultaneously;
Step 2, tightly pushes down two by group's dental structure of four set stabilising arrangement 16 terminations in driving part 1 and helps rib, make Driving part 2 relies on the pressure that both sides coal helped by stabilising arrangement 16, formed one can not around, have the steady of displacement up and down Fixed entirety;
Step 3, driving part 1 is formed after stablize entirety, cutting part 11 rotary table 12 and upper and lower, swing oil cylinder Effect under, can up and down, the cutting coal of left and right;
Step 4, passage oil cylinder 3 pulls framework for support part 2 to move forward one to form stable overall driving part 1 for fulcrum Individual driving step office (about 0.9m), as shown in Figure 4;
Four set stabilising arrangements 16 in driving part 1 are regained, are completed a P. drechsleri by step 5.
